Hey guys,
I've done some more work this weekend on the search results.


http://skitch.com/jdumay/6cc2/archiva-search-results-w-no-duplicates-repository-id-or-versions-displayed

So far:
* There are no duplicate entries.
* I've removed the link to the repository the result was from (otherwise we might have two copies of "commons-lang" appearing in the results but from different repositories. IMO, this information can be found on the artifact
info page).
* Removed the versions available.
* Clicking on the artifact link now takes you to browse the versions.

Thoughts?

I visited James today and we came up with this list of things to fix a
bit more urgently (I'll be putting them in JIRA later).

Already changed:
* remove dependencies/filecontent from the quick search - must not search
for dependencies on commons-lang
* change the default search to AND instead of OR

Still to look at:
- [ ] improve the search results page
    - [ ] remove metadata files
    - [ ] merge versions in search results
    - [ ] for snapshots, just show SNAPSHOT, not timestamps
- [ ] show hits in the results (this may not be possible or needed
with better results, however)

- [ ] existing JIRA complaints
    - [ ] MRM-732 (tokenizing)
    - [ ] MRM-495 (weighting)
    - [ ] MRM-609 (windows bug - may be fixed)
    - [ ] MRM-933 (hit count, pagination completely busted)

- [ ] advanced search
- [ ] improve appearance and flexibility, maybe change to "add term"
buttons on the default search
    - [ ] class/package search is still flaky
- [ ] might be the analyzer rules, etc. for splitting on '.'

- [ ] browse improvements
- [ ] artifact version list should show basic shared project information
rather than having to drill into one version
- [ ] snapshot should go to a page that shows a list of versions
      (go to latest, but list previous snapshots)

Hey guys,
As mentioned on IRC we all agreed that our search feature is a little
suboptimal.

I would like to propose the following improvements:
* Search should be more like mvnrepository.com (showing codebase growth
etc).
* We should figure out a way of using up stream repository indexes to
improve search results.
* Advanced search needs a good rethink - we should probably use a filter approach so that you could do bytecode: search results that include free
text search.
* UI improvements so that the user experience feels more intuitive.
